Alex was a 37-year-old ICU nurse who worked for the Veterans
Administration. His job was to take care of those who had served our
country when they were sick and injured. His family and friends say he was
a kind soul who enjoyed hiking and camping.
When George Floyd was murdered by police in Alex’s own neighborhood in
2020, he joined the local protests and stood in solidarity with his
community. Alex did the same when Renee Good was murdered just weeks ago
by ICE. He is one of hundreds of thousands of Minnesotans who have
protested, documented, and resisted ICE’s campaign of terror over the last
month.
Alex’s final act before being killed was to help a woman who was being
beaten by immigration agents on the side of the road. Alex was swarmed by
a team of agents, pepper-sprayed, wrestled to the ground, and shot several
times.
